The goal of this research is to determine whether the causal relationship betweenfinancial development and economic growth in Turkey is stable over time. For thispurpose, causal relationship between financial development and economic growthin Turkey has been investigated by means of annual data for the period of 1960-2013. Differently from previous studies in the literature, considering that causalrelationship between financial development and economic growth might changedepending on time, time-varying causality test developed by Balcilar, Ozdemir andArslanturk (2010) has been used. The results show that there is a unidirectionalcausal relationship from financial development to economic growth and thisrelationship changes depending on time. It is seen that unidirectional causalityfrom financial development to economic growth emerged during the periods offinancial turmoil and political crisis. The basic conclusion is that there is no stablecausal relationship between financial development and economic growth in Turkeyover the given time period.
